Home
last modified time | relevance | path

Searched refs:CachedShadowData (Results 1 – 1 of 1) sorted by relevance

/dports/games/warzone2100/warzone2100/lib/ivis_opengl/
H A Dpiedraw.cpp417 struct CachedShadowData { struct
421 CachedShadowData() { } in CachedShadowData() function
424 …typedef std::unordered_map<ShadowDrawParameters, CachedShadowData> ShadowDrawParametersToCachedDat…
427 …const CachedShadowData* findCacheForShadowDraw(iIMDShape *shape, int flag, int flag_data, const gl… in findCacheForShadowDraw()
442CachedShadowData& createCacheForShadowDraw(iIMDShape *shape, int flag, int flag_data, const glm::v… in createCacheForShadowDraw()
444 …result = shapeMap[shape].emplace(ShadowDrawParameters(flag, flag_data, light), CachedShadowData()); in createCacheForShadowDraw()
449 void addPremultipliedVertexes(const CachedShadowData& cachedData, const glm::mat4 &modelViewMatrix) in addPremultipliedVertexes()
553 …const ShadowCache::CachedShadowData *pCached = shadowCache.findCacheForShadowDraw(shape, flag, fla… in pie_DrawShadow()
622 …ShadowCache::CachedShadowData& cache = shadowCache.createCacheForShadowDraw(shape, flag, flag_data… in pie_DrawShadow()